NCT ID: NCT02325960
Brief Summary: This is a 16-week, Single-center, Randomized, Open Label, Parallel Controlled Group Comparison of the Comprehensive Glycemic Control of Exenatide and Insulin Glargine on Type 2 Diabetes Patients Inadequately Controlled With Metformin Monotherapy.
Detailed Description: Screening will be made to select eligible patients, then 44 patients receiving a stable dose of metformin (≥1500 mg daily) will be randomized (1:1) to receive exenatide or insulin glargine for 16 weeks. Exenatide will be administered twice daily by subcutaneous injection 30- 60 minutes before breakfast and dinner; the dose was 5 μg twice-daily for the first 4 weeks of treatment and 10 μg thereafter. Insulin glargine will be administered once daily at bedtime by subcutaneous injection. The dose of insulin glargine will initiate at ≥8 IU once-daily, and titrate based on a dosing algorithm targeting fasting blood glucose (FPG)\<6.1 mmol/L. Titration is only allowed in first 4 weeks. At the end of the study, data will be collected and analyzed.
